THE
PNEUMATIC BAND APPLICATION TOOL… is a cost
effective system that speeds production and improves ergonomic conditions
which are present when manual tools are used. Band tension is precisely
applied by a dependable pneumatic system which is consistent and
repeatable. The calibration system of the pneumatic band tool is
adjustable, and can be checked by use of the calibration devices available
from DMC. The cutter blade and
other components of the DMC
Pneumatic Band tools are interchangeable with the DBS-1100 and DBS-1200
series hand tools. The rugged design and field replaceable blades make the
PBT/PMBT series the best choice for production applications where EMI/RFI
bands are used to terminate wire harness shielding. |
THE HAND OPERATED BAND
APPLICATION TOOL… is an excellent choice for
many production and maintenance operations. Like the power driven models,
they too can be calibrated by the user to provide reliable terminations
throughout the service life. The lightweight construction and small "nose"
profile enable the user to apply termination bands in even the tightest of
working areas. Models are available for .250 in. (6.350 mm) and .125 in.
(3.175 mm) wide bands from all current suppliers.

DBS-R03 ROLL-OVER FOR .250 WIDE
BANDS APPLICATION TOOL
The
DMC Roll-Over tool (Part
No. DBS-RO3) Is used to fold the extended band tab securely over the
buckle. Experts agree that the "folded tab" method assures maximum
strength and reliability. Like other DMC
Band Application Tools, the Roll-Over Tool is compatible with all
currently available bands. DMC
also provides the DBS-RO4 Roll-Over Tool for use with .125 wide Mini-
Bands. This tool is similar to the
DBS-RO3 in size and shape. |
CALIBRATION OF EMI/RFI BAND TOOLS
 |
All the
DMC Hand and Pneumatic Band
Application Tools may be calibrated to insure correct band tension.
This calibration fixture will allow the operator to gage
the exact tension produced by the tool.
A short piece of unused band material
is fed into the tool far enough to fully engage the gripping
mechanism. The other end is then inserted and latched into the
calibration fixture. Full tension is then exerted by the tool and read
directly on the precision dial indicator portion of the calibration
fixture. Simple adjustments can be made to the tool. A quick release
mechanism is provided to allow the operator to easily remove the tool
from the test fixture.
FIELD CALIBRATION FIXTURES &
GO/NO-GO GAUGES were developed to allow the user a quick means of
checking calibration of band application tools in the field. A band is
placed into the calibration fixture. The band is drawn through the
tool until the nose of the banding tool is firmly against the
calibration fixture. Once the full banding pressure has been applied,
insert the "GO' side of the Gage into the verification slot of the
calibration fixture. If it does not insert freely, the tool is
exerting excessive force. Likewise, if the NO-GO probe freely enters
the verification slot, the tool is below the minimum force, thus
alerting the user that the tool is out of calibration.

Careful measurement
should be made prior to installing the backshell. The outer jacket is
then uniformly removed at a distance which would allow the braid to
make a comfortable transition onto the backshell termination area.
This dimension will vary depending upon the differences between cable
and backshell diameters or other application dependent factors.
The braid is then
trimmed to a length which will allow it to extend 1 inch past the
backshell termination platform. Then the braid is carefully folded
rearward to expose the wires which will be inside the backshell.
A sufficient number
of wraps of self vulcanizing tape (normally red in colour) are applied
over the wires to build-up a diameter slightly less than the inside
diameter of the backshell. Care should be taken not to apply tension
to the contacts located in the outer perimeter of the connector.
These layers of tape
are followed by a minimum of one layer of Teflon tape which will
prevent adhesion with the backshell and other components.
The backshell is then
installed onto the connector, using a nonabrasive tool such as a strap
wrench. The braid is then carefully moved from under the backshell. It
is important to retain the woven characteristics of the braid during
this step.
Use self vulcanizing
tape or a pre-formed component to build up the area behind the
backshell. It is important that the braid is supported in the
transition from the backshell rear diameter to the natural diameter of
the wire bundle. Leave approximately 1/8 inch spacing between the tape
wrap and the backshell.
The braid is pushed
into position over the backshell termination platform. Care must be
taken to make sure the weave is uniform and no large "windows" are
present. A shield termination band is then loaded into the tool. The
band is then slid over the connector/backshell assembly into a
position of alignment with the termination platform. Apply an adequate
amount of pressure in line with the cable as it enters the backshell
to allow the 1/8 inch space to be reduced to zero. The tool is then
activated to the pre-set tension. The band is then bent sharply at the
buckle approximately 90° then cut-off using the cut-off lever on the
tool. If band is un-curled for any reason, it must be double looped
thru the buckle, before termination.
The 90° tab is then
curled and folded back over the buckle using the roll-over tool.
For braided a
non-jacket cable use fine point shears to trim the excess braid as
close to the connector side of the bands as possible. Do not leave any
unsecured braid wires longer than 1/8 inch. Do not allow the trimmed
wires to fall into any areas where they may present a foreign object
damage hazard.

PROCEDURE FOR
MID CABLE SPLICING
The jacket is
present, and shield are cut and separated to expose the wires
requiring service. Care must be taken to avoid damaging the insulation
on internal wires. The required service is then completed.
The wire bundle is
then protected by a few wraps of self vulcanizing tape followed by 2-3
layers of Teflon tape. An appropriate size split ring set is then
selected and installed.
One layer of Teflon
tape is applied over the split ring set to hold the halves in position
while the next steps are being performed.
The braid is then
overlapped across the split ring set. Be sure the braid ends protrude
completely under the band in both directions.
Heat shrinkable tape is then applied
over the splice. Where a jacketed cable is used, be sure the tape
extends onto the jacket in both directions.
